Grafting is a technique that has been used for centuries to propagate plants with specific characteristics, such as disease resistance, fruit size, or growth habit. By joining a scion (the top part of one plant) to a rootstock (the bottom part of another plant), growers can create a new plant that combines the best traits of both. This allows them to produce plants that are better adapted to their environment, more productive, or simply more attractive.
